Official statistics provide information on the number of crimes collected directly from each police officer. They claim to provide answers to the two questions; the extent of the crime and those who committed the crime. Criminologists have found an official statistical problem that incorrectly describes the extent and type of crime actually present. Therefore, other types of information shifts include victim surveys, longitudinal studies, and self reporting studies.
